This first assignment aims to get you deeply acquainted with a performance-focused artist of your choice. This artist will serve as your guiding inspiration for the rest of the semester so choose thoughtfully – the work of this artist must be relevant to social critique, social change, or advocacy in some way! Your task is to create a pamphlet or mini-zine (6-8 pages) that,

1) describes the artist’s work, themes they deal with, and some important performances they have done,

2) the historical, cultural, and political context in which their work emerges. How does their work address, advance, or create social change? What kind of social change?

3) the styles and methods they use to create their performances. This is a fan-zine, so approach this as an opportunity to share with other what you love about this artist.

The text you include in the zine can be in the form of blurbs, quotations, fun facts, background information, manifestos, and most importantly some insightful critical analysis of the artist’s work.

You can use graphics, pictures, hand-drawings, stickers, etc. Zines are low-fi, underground modes of sharing knowledge – so have fun with it! Become an expert on this artist and share with us – the top three zines will be duplicated and circulated to the department – yes, it is an informal contest!
